Airtel To Kickoff FDD-LTE Based 4G Trial In Chennai From Today; Mumbai, Hyderabad Next

Bharti Airtel will start 4G services trial in Chennai from today, followed by Mumbai and Hyderabad by the end of this month.

"Airtel will start trial of 4G services in Chennai from May 14 in 1800 Mhz band. It has sent out invite to some bloggers to experience its services," according to a source.

"The company's network to launch FDD LTE (4G) in Hyderabad is also ready. The trials for the same is expected to start this month. In Mumbai, the company will provide TDD LTE (4G) in 2300 Mhz band. The trial for Mumbai 4G service is also planned for this month," the source added according to Economic times.

As of now, Airtel provides 4G services in 19 cities across the country including, Kolkata, Bengaluru, Pune, Chandigarh, Mohali and Panchkula.

Bharti Airtel Chairman Sunil Bharti Mittal in March said that the company has plans to double its 4G network by installing about 20,000 more sites in addition to 20,000 sites it already has for 4G service.
